Do you need a wallet to store cryptocurrencies?
When it comes to the realm of cryptocurrencies, a question that often arises is: 'Do I need a wallet to store my digital assets?' The answer is a definitive yes. A cryptocurrency wallet serves as a secure digital container where you can store, receive, and send your coins or tokens. Think of it as a virtual bank account, but with the added benefit of decentralized control and encryption-backed security. Without a wallet, you would be unable to effectively manage or transact with your cryptocurrencies. So, whether you're a crypto enthusiast or just dipping your toes into the market, securing a wallet is a crucial first step.
